摘要:
本文目标 30分钟内让你明白正则表达式是什么,并对它有一些基本的了解,让你可以在自己的程序或网页里使用它。 如何使用本教程 最重要的是——请给我30分钟, 如果你没有使用正则表达式的经验,请不要试图在30秒内入门——除非你是超人 :) 别被下面那些复杂的表达式吓倒,只要跟着我一步一步来,你会发现正则
阅读全文
posted @ 2016-09-21 23:33
四海一家
阅读(302)
推荐(0)
编辑
摘要:
正则表达式 - 示例 简单表达式 正则表达式的最简单形式是在搜索字符串中匹配其本身的单个普通字符。例如,单字符模式,如 A,不论出现在搜索字符串中的何处,它总是匹配字母 A。下面是一些单字符正则表达式模式的示例: 可以将许多单字符组合起来以形成大的表达式。例如,以下正则表达式组合了单字符表达式:a、
阅读全文
posted @ 2016-09-21 20:45
四海一家
阅读(177)
推荐(0)
编辑
摘要:
正则表达式 - 匹配规则 基本模式匹配 一切从最基本的开始。模式,是正规表达式最基本的元素,它们是一组描述字符串特征的字符。模式可以很简单,由普通的字符串组成,也可以非常复杂,往往用特殊的字符表示一个范围内的字符、重复出现,或表示上下文。例如: 这个模式包含一个特殊的字符^,表示该模式只匹配那些以o
阅读全文
posted @ 2016-09-21 20:44
四海一家
阅读(317)
推荐(0)
编辑
摘要:
正则表达式 - 运算符优先级 正则表达式从左到右进行计算,并遵循优先级顺序,这与算术表达式非常类似。 相同优先级的从左到右进行运算,不同优先级的运算先高后低。下表从最高到最低说明了各种正则表达式运算符的优先级顺序: 运算符描述 \ 转义符 (), (?:), (?=), [] 圆括号和方括号 *,
阅读全文
posted @ 2016-09-21 20:43
四海一家
阅读(209)
推荐(0)
编辑
摘要:
正则表达式 - 元字符 下表包含了元字符的完整列表以及它们在正则表达式上下文中的行为:
阅读全文
posted @ 2016-09-21 20:42
四海一家
阅读(162)
推荐(0)
编辑
摘要:
正则表达式 - 语法 正则表达式(regular expression)描述了一种字符串匹配的模式,可以用来检查一个串是否含有某种子串、将匹配的子串做替换或者从某个串中取出符合某个条件的子串等。 列目录时, dir *.txt或ls *.txt中的*.txt就不是一个正则表达式,因为这里*与正则式的
阅读全文
posted @ 2016-09-21 20:32
四海一家
阅读(104)
推荐(0)
编辑